Thema: Info: Millennium - The King
Einzelnen Beitrag anzeigen
  #518  
Alt 14.07.2020, 10:39
Benutzerbild von Mythbuster
Mythbuster Mythbuster ist offline
Forengrinch
 
Registriert seit: 06.04.2008
Ort: UNESCO Welterbe
Land:
Beiträge: 6.931
Abgegebene Danke: 1.469
Erhielt 4.641 Danke für 1.538 Beiträge
Member Photo Albums
Aktivitäten Langlebigkeit
8/20 16/20
Heute Beiträge
0/3 sssss6931
AW: Millennium - The King

 Zitat von Rasmus Beitrag anzeigen

Wenn man übliche ca. 60 Elo pro Verdoppelung der Rechenzeit annimmt, wären 200 Elo allein durch die schnellere Hardware zu erklären. Das liegt also durchaus im zu erwartenden Rahmen.
Hallo Rasmus. Das mit den 50 bis 70 Elo ist eine Geschichte, die sich so nicht mehr hält. Sie stammt aus den Anfangszeiten des Computerschachs. Damals stimmte es (zum Teil) noch. Was richtig ist: Bei einem reinen Brute Force Programm bringt ein zusätzlicher Halbzug Rechentiefe ca. 200 Elo. Und ein reines BF Programm benötigt die siebenfache Rechenzeit, um einen HZ tiefer zu rechnen. Aber schon hier merkt man schnell, dass man mit einer Verdoppelung der Rechenzeit nicht weit kommt ... denn damit man einen Effekt erreicht, muss hier der bessere Zug ohnehin schon weit vorn in der Zugliste sein ...

Bei den selektiven und wissensbasierten Programmen setzte sich dann die 50 bis 70 Elo Regel bei Verdoppelung der Rechenzeit durch. Das Problem hier: Das funktioniert nur in einem "Sweetspot Bereich" ... danach nimmt der Zuwachs immer weiter ab. Einfaches Beispiel: Wenn Du den Glasgow auf dem Rev II AE noch einmal weiter beschleunigst, was in der Emu am PC leicht machbar ist, wirst Du bei Verdoppelung keinen messbaren Zugewinn mehr erreichen.

Warum? Dafür gibt es mehrere Gründe:

1. Die Programme haben in der Regel eine begrenzte Rechentiefe ... wenn sie die erreicht haben, ist Ende.

2. Der Speicher ist begrenzt.

3. Der Hauptgrund ist genau das, was sie auszeichnet, ihr Wissen oder auch das "nicht Wissen": Und genau das ändert sich ja nicht. In vielen Fällen ziehen sie den falschen Zug "aus Überzeugung" ... da hilft auch mehr Speed dann nicht mehr.

Ein einfaches Beispiel: Wenn ein Computer das "Falsche Läufer" Endspiel kennt, kann mehr Geschwindigkeit helfen, da er im Vorwege tiefer rechnen kann und genau so eine Stellung anstreben kann ... wenn er es nicht kennt ... tja, dann wird er immer falsch ziehen, egal, wie tief oder schnell er rechnet.

Davon abgesehen zeigt der King schon bei 30 MHz (R30 Speed), dass er deutlich verbessert wurde ... der R30 hat hier keine Chance mehr. In unserer Turnierliste liegt der King mit 50 Mhz bei 2.438 Elo, der R30 2.5 bei 2.335 Elo.

Gruß,
Sascha
__________________
This post may not be reproduced without prior written permission.
Copyright (c) 1967-2024. All rights reserved to make me feel special. :-)
Mit Zitat antworten